    Winners of the 2024 Thinkering Grant

    The 2024 C²DH ‘Thinkering Grant’ went to the ‘Rust and Research’ team which submitted a proposal to create a card game based on time travelling on the Belval campus and exploring both its unique industrial heritage and its transition to Luxembourg’s first and foremost location to do research.

    Introducing the Warlux website on Luxembourgish soldiers during WWII

    The Warlux website, focusing on wartime experiences of young Luxembourgish men who served in the German labour service and armed forces during World War II, is now online.

    Call for papers – CONDE conference in 2025

    In June 2025, the C²DH will be hosting the international conference “Confronting Decline (CONDE) – Challenges of Deindustrialization in European Societies since the 1970s”.
